Output 1393319fee5ed42f757145b9677e49b060e2351def85fa05e108e7b7c525e7ee:0

value
40489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b27fa852e0a47777b4539bbf8ecc5fbf05890e71 OP_EQUAL
address
MQAySNjppdKzfdEvAqHPFULj6AtknXdgWt
transaction
1393319fee5ed42f757145b9677e49b060e2351def85fa05e108e7b7c525e7ee
spent
true